Fuencaliente on La Palma – Holiday Homes & Travel

Volcanic Wonders and Wine Delights in La Palma

The most important information for Fuencaliente in La Palma

Welcome to Fuencaliente, the jewel of the south of La Palma, an island known for its untouched beauty and volcanic landscapes. Fuencaliente, or "Fuente Caliente," named after its hot springs, is a place where nature and tradition merge in a unique way, offering visitors an unparalleled experience.

Impressive Volcanic Landscapes
This picturesque municipality is famous for its stunning volcanic landscapes, especially the San Antonio and Teneguía volcanoes, whose last eruption occurred in 1971. The fields of black lava and the rich flora and fauna create a breathtaking backdrop for hikers and nature lovers. For those eager to explore the secrets of the volcanoes, the San Antonio Visitor Center provides fascinating insights into the island's volcanic history.

Wines and Local Cuisine
Fuencaliente is also known for its excellent wines that thrive in the mineral-rich volcanic soils of the region. Wine lovers can visit local wineries to experience unique flavors and learn more about winemaking in this exceptional terroir. Its cuisine is also notable for its authenticity, with meats carefully prepared in traditional recipes and fresh Atlantic fish as the centerpiece of typical dishes. For a sweet touch, the almendrados, made with local almonds, conquer any palate with their crunchy texture and exquisite flavor, reflecting the cultural and culinary richness of this Palmera corner.

Dream Beaches
The coast of Fuencaliente offers beautiful beaches like Playa de Echentive, known for its black volcanic rocks and crystal-clear waters. It is an ideal place to relax, sunbathe, and engage in water activities.

Culture and Tradition
Visitors interested in culture can explore village life in Fuencaliente, which offers traditional architecture and the warmth of the locals. The Church of San Antonio Abad and the Salt Museum are just a few cultural highlights worth visiting.
